Shooting ‘defensive’
THE US police officer charged with the murder of Australian life coach Justine Ruszczyk Damond appears set to claim self-defence and plead not guilty.
Minneapolis cop Mohamed Noor shot dead Ms Damond in an alley behind her home just before midnight on July 25.
Ms Damond, a former Sydneysider who moved to Minneapolis, called 911 after hearing a woman’s screams.
When she approached Noor’s police car in the alley he shot across his partner and out the vehicle’s window, striking Ms Damond fatally.
